Andrews Kurth Builds Corporate Securities Practice in D.C.

June 28, 2004

WASHINGTON -- Andrews Kurth’s Washington, D.C. office welcomes Andy Tucker as a partner in its Corporate Securities practice. Tom Kline, managing partner of the Washington, D.C. office, says,“ Andrews Kurth will benefit from the character, background and interests of Andy Tucker. Mr. Tucker is highly regarded throughout the Washington business community as a fine lawyer and has been listed as one of the most influential people in the local technology sector. We are fortunate to have Andy Tucker join our office and to have him become part of our firm wide team of Corporate Securities lawyers.”

Tucker’s broad corporate securities practice includes the representation of issuers and underwriters in capital markets transactions, venture capital/emerging company work, as well as mergers and acquisitions and buy-out fund work. Tucker has been a panelist on numerous discussions regarding securities laws topics, such as the public offering process and compliance with the mandates of Sarbanes-Oxley. Tucker says, “I am excited about the opportunity at Andrews Kurth. The broad corporate practice coupled with the focus on technology company representation truly reflects the dynamic corporate environment in Washington.”

In 1987, Tucker graduated cum laude from Georgetown University Law Center and is a 1984 honors graduate of the University of Notre Dame. Tucker resides in Arlington, Virginia with his wife and two children. He is a member of the of the Business Law Council of the Virginia Bar Association, which advises on changes to the corporate and securities laws in Virginia.

Andrews Kurth LLP, founded in 1902, has more than 400 lawyers and eight offices in Austin, Dallas, Houston, London, Los Angeles, New York, The Woodlands and Washington, DC. The firm has an international client base and has experience in all major industries and areas of business law and litigation.
